Replacement-Windows-150x150.jpgRepairing UPVC Windows

The durability and energy efficiency of uPVC windows is increasing their popularity. However, uPVC windows can become damaged over time and some damage may require repair.

Repairs are usually more affordable than replacing your windows. They also are less disruptive to your daily routine. Repairing your windows will also increase the efficiency of your home's energy and appearance.

Cracks

uPVC is designed to be durable and energy efficient, as well as long-lasting. However, they could be damaged. It is crucial to repair a window crack as soon as you can. If you don't do it, the crack could spread and cause further damage to your home. A uPVC expert can fix the window and stop further damage.

Your uPVC windows can crack for several reasons. Temperature fluctuations are the most frequent reason. The sudden rise or decrease in temperature can cause cracks to appear. This is especially true when the glass is in an area that is exposed.

A uPVC frame crack can be caused by damage. It can be caused by hitting the window with a heavy object, or by leaning the ladder against it. The pressure that results can cause the frame crack or even break.

Fortunately, cracks in uPVC windows can be fixed fairly easily. The first step is cleaning the crack with water and detergent. After that, you should fill the crack with a patch of acrylic compound. Apply the compound within two minutes of mixing it and ensure that it is absorbed into the crack. The patch should be sanded to make it smooth.

If your uPVC window handle is starting to squeak, this is typically caused by the spindle that controls the internal locking mechanism inside the handle. To solve this issue you can make use of a lubricant that's safe for plastics, like WD-40 or 3-in-1 oil. It is also important to keep the lock and handle clean to prevent dust from building up.

Black mould is a common issue with uPVC windows. It can be caused by a variety of factors, including temperature, humidity and ventilation. It is easy to treat, however, by rubbing the surface with soap and warm water. You can also use dehumidifiers to decrease the amount of humidity in your home.

Scratches

UPVC is, although it is a tough and flexible material, is susceptible to damage from mechanical forces like pitting or scratches. There are many ways to repair this type of damage. The first step is to examine the scratched surface and determine its severity. If it is deep enough that you are able to feel it with your fingernail, then it is likely to be buffed using finer and more intense sandpaper to eliminate it completely. If it is shallow, then a quick buff will probably solve the problem.

It is recommended to clean the glass thoroughly with glass cleaner prior to you try any of these DIY techniques. Dry it completely. This will remove any dirt or debris which could cause scratches to worsen or make them more visible. The next step is to make use of a soft, lint-free fabric to clean the surface of the glass that has been damaged. Microfibre cloths are ideal for this task as they can withstand moisture and resist scratching, and are easy to wash. Paper towels and other cleaners that are abrasive should be avoided since they may etch or scratch the surface of your glass.

If your uPVC windows have scratches on the surface You should try to remove them with the help of materials that are commonly found in your home. This can be done with regular white toothpaste, but especially when it contains baking powder. Apply a small amount of paste to a clean, soft lint-free cloth and gently rub it over the area of scratched in circular motions. After approximately 30 seconds, uPVC repairs check the result and repeat the process until the scratches are completely gone.

You can also use a polish specifically made for plastic surfaces, like brass cleaner or T-Cut to remove scratches from your uPVC windows. Ensure that you use the polish as per the directions, and be cautious to avoid over-application, as too much can cause etching or dulling of the windows' surface.

UPVC windows are a fantastic option due to their strength and versatility. It is also less expensive than wood or aluminium making it a cost-effective alternative. However, UPVC windows require regular maintenance to avoid major problems. They will last longer by keeping them clean and well-lubricated. This will prevent problems such as rust or rot.

Dirt or grime can cause stiff handles, faulty locks, or problems opening windows. Cleaning windows with soapy water will help remove the dirt. You should also lubricate the hinges on your windows. Regular use of WD-40 will keep them in good working order.

It is essential to repair or replace your UPVC windows as soon as they are damaged. Regular cleaning with a damp cloth and soapy water can help prevent the need for extensive repairs. You should also apply lubrication to any exposed metal parts regularly by spraying silicone to prevent rusting. Also, you should clean the uPVC frames of your windows on a regular basis to remove dust, dirt and cobwebs.

When the seals of UPVC windows begin to wear out water can get through the glass panes and cause discoloration and mold. This is a common issue in older homes however it can be easily fixed by replacing the seals with silicone rubber. Keep your UPVC window as clean as you can, especially around corners, to prevent obstructions in drainage holes.

If you have a window that is difficult to open or close, this can be a sign that the hinges or locks have worn out.
